Life expectancy in Shanghai is over 83 years old, what are the reasons for the longevity of Shanghai people?

, people's longevity has a lot to do with the degree of development of society. Before the establishment of the People's Republic of China *** and the State, Chinese society in general is in a state of turmoil, when the average life expectancy is less than 40 years old, even at the beginning of the establishment of the new China, the average life expectancy is also under 60 years old. Further back. Ancient China's peacetime life expectancy are also under 50 years old, mainly because of the lack of social productivity, medical conditions do not meet the needs of human longevity, disease has always been the main reason for the shortening of human life expectancy, in less developed areas of poorer medical conditions, many people can not find their own physical condition in time there is a problem, and after the discovery of the problem can not be effectively treated, resulting in a much shorter life expectancy.

Shanghai, as the economic center of China, has very high social productivity and correspondingly good medical conditions, and similarly, people's level of affluence is much higher than in other parts of China. In affluent areas, people are more likely to have regular medical checkups and receive early treatment for any illnesses they find, and the advanced medical care and social security systems allow residents to enjoy a higher level of healthcare.
